import.io features and specs

  • Ease of Use
    Import.io offers a user-friendly interface that allows users to easily extract data without needing to write code, making it accessible for non-technical users.
  • Data Integration
    The platform provides robust integration options with various analytics and data storage tools, enabling seamless data workflows.
  • Scalability
    Import.io can handle large volumes of data efficiently, making it suitable for both small and large-scale data extraction projects.
  • Speed
    The tool is designed to extract data quickly, minimizing the time required to obtain and process large datasets.
  • Data Transformation
    Offers features for data transformation and cleaning, allowing users to manipulate the data to fit their needs before export.

Possible disadvantages of import.io

  • Cost
    Import.io can be expensive, especially for businesses or users requiring extensive data extraction and processing capabilities.
  •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    While basic features are easy to use, mastering the more advanced functionalities can require a significant amount of time and effort.
  • Limited Customization
    There are constraints on customization, which could be limiting for users with complex or highly specific data extraction needs.
  • Occasional Stability Issues
    Users have reported occasional performance and stability issues, which can cause interruptions during data extraction processes.
  • Dependency on Web Structure
    The tool is highly dependent on the structure of the target websites. Any changes in the website's layout can disrupt data extraction processes and require reconfiguration.

React Helmet features and specs

  • SEO Optimization
    React Helmet allows for dynamic manipulation of document head elements, enabling improved SEO by updating meta tags, title, and other head elements on the fly.
  • Server-Side Rendering Support
    React Helmet integrates well with server-side rendering, ensuring that head elements are properly rendered, which is crucial for SEO and faster page loads.
  • Ease of Use
    Provides a simple API for managing head tags declaratively within React components, making it easy for developers to use without needing to manipulate the DOM directly.
  • Integration with React Ecosystem
    Seamlessly integrates with React applications, supporting React component patterns and life cycles which makes it a natural choice for handling head management in React apps.

Possible disadvantages of React Helmet

  • Additional Dependency
    Adding React Helmet to a project introduces an extra dependency that developers have to maintain, potentially increasing the bundle size.
  • Client-Side Only Limitations
    React Helmet manipulations occur after the JavaScript has run, which could lead to a brief delay in updating head content, potentially affecting initial page load content.
  • Potential Overhead
    For small applications or simple websites, the overhead of including a library like React Helmet might be unnecessary, leading to increased complexity without significant benefits.
  • Complexity with Nested Components
    Managing head tags across deeply nested components can be complex and may require additional architectural considerations to ensure head changes are predictable and manageable.

  • A guide to React 19’s new Document Metadata feature
    Document Metadata is convenient and secure because it is built into React, whereas SEO libraries like React Helmet have security issues. React Helmet hasn't had a GitHub commit since 2020, though it still garners about 1 million weekly downloads on npm. Despite its popularity, the project was abandoned due to data integrity and leakage issues. Consequently, Scott Taylor, the developer of React Helmet, archived it... - Source: dev.to / 11 months ago
